I hope you won't find this offensive, but the post you linked as a "primer" on Globalstar's prospects is a vacuous, fact-deficient puff piece. The people who really know what is going on with Globalstar are Valueman, RocketScientist, and Maurice Winn, probably others but those are the ones I give most credence to. And you can't know anything about Globalstar without knowing what's going on with Loral. KyrosL, who posts on this board, has invested in both Globalstar and Loral, and follows the companies, too. For what it's worth, my take on Globalstar is that the chances that it will file bankruptcy are very high, and that is based on hard, cold financial calculations that very intelligent posters on the thread have done. I think the prospects for a complex project like Globalstar or Teledesic to make enough money to survive are poor.
